Senators John McCain (R-AZ) and Bob Corker (R-TN) have a lot in common. Today, however, what they’ve got most in common is that they’re both using their positions to undermine President Trump.

Corker told the leader in fake news, CNN, that Trump was “debasing the nation” and that he couldn’t support Trump again.

Corker calling Trump a liar:

“I think world leaders are very aware that much of what he says is untrue. Certainly, people here are because these things are provably untrue, I mean, they are factually incorrect and people know the difference. I don’t know why he lowers himself to such a low, low standard, and debases our country in a way that he does, but he does.”

Corker saying Trump is bad for our nation:

“I think the things that are happening right now that are harmful to our nation, whether it’s the breaking down of when are we going to be doing hearings on some of the things that he purposely is breaking down, relationships we have around the world that have been useful to our nation, but I think at the end of the day when his term is over, I think the debasing of our nation, the constant non-truth telling, and the — just the name-calling, the things that I think the debasement of our nation is what he will be remembered most for, and that’s regretful. And it affects young people. I mean, we have young people who for the first time are watching a president, stating, you know, absolute non-truths nonstop. Personalizing things in the way that he does. It’s very sad for our nation.”
